RE: Online Progress Reports
As in the past, the on-line progress reports are extremely helpful in notifying us about students who are experiencing difficulty in your class. Early notification helps alert a student’s advisor about problems while there is still time to effect a change in the student’s performance. Since students having difficulty in one class are often experiencing problems in other classes, this is especially important.
Easy to do: Click on http://www.lsa.umich.edu/facstaff/saa/, then on LSA Undergraduate Student Progress Report (the second link), and follow the directions.
We are requesting that you fill in the student data, which is easily accessible through your Class Roster on Wolverine Access, and check the appropriate boxes. There is also space for your comments. Please note that when the form is submitted to us, copies are sent simultaneously to the student’s academic advisor for follow-up purposes and to the student.
The on-line report allows us to respond promptly to students experiencing academic difficulty. For your information the deadline to drop courses for this term is Friday, March 16, 2007.
